Job Purpose:

The HR Information Systems Architect will provide technical leadership and expertise in driving the HR systems architecture design and deployment strategies. This position will partner with Employee Experience, IT, Infrastructure, Cyber Security and Enterprise Applications teams to evaluate, select and integrate systems and maximize HR’s technical investments. The Architect will translate HR business needs and challenges into technical strategies, solutions, and tools to enable data driven decision making. Use expertise and consultation to drive innovation in system design and functionality. Simplify and optimize processes with enhanced workflows and standards.

Primary Functions:

  • Lead and provide subject matter expertise for the definition, configuration, and delivery of successful HRIS and Talent Management systems to drive people centered analytics.

  • Build an in-depth understanding of the Employee Experience’s (EE) current and future process, data, reporting and system needs. Assess the impact of operational projects, map system requirements to standard business processes, and lead process-based workflow designs and approvals;

  • Collaborate with appropriate stakeholders for business process definition, configuration, testing and training support - including key tasks, milestones, and deliverables – to ensure alignment of solutions with current systems;

  • Work with internal and external partners and departments to ensure data integration or API design to build/support relationships between the HR and other systems such as Payroll, Records, applicant tracking systems (ATS), learning management systems (LMS) and other related technology platforms;

  • Recommend innovative ways to automate HR functions and processes to gain system and process efficiencies;

  • Create and implement an audit schedule to review the integrity of data in the HRIS and databases; serve as a liaison for annual data testing and auditing for HR team and other compliance requirements;

  • Lead process improvement audits, identify/recommend solutions and partner to implement process improvement initiatives that streamline operations, advance the use of technology, improve benchmarking and accountability, ensure data accuracy, reliability, and security while providing efficient and timely processing;

  • Coach, and mentor the HRIS team; Counsel EE leadership on system best practices, capabilities and improvements to enhance data based decision-making;

  • Consult with EE leaders and other departments to determine and solution people analytics needs that include but are not limited to metrics, reporting, data visualization and modeling, system updates and improvements;

  • Debrief EE leadership regularly to identify key HR performance indicators. Lead the development, implementation and maintenance of a dashboard of HR metrics to be presented at monthly, quarterly, and annual senior leadership meetings;

  • Assess user reporting requirements and recommend appropriate report and/or reporting tools and report templates. Modify/customize reports to meet user and business needs. Create ad-hoc reports and dashboards by extracting data from enterprise and talent systems using available reporting tools;

  • Develop training materials and provide ongoing end-user training to ensure full use of system capabilities;

  • Partner with the Digital and Technology support team for application upgrade testing, troubleshoot system issues, identify root-cause and implement solutions to minimize or prevent occurrences;

  • Collaborate on system updates and usability improvements and testing to ensure efficient and effective processes; Conduct system testing for upgrades, UAT for customizations and lead system related change management efforts;

  • Lead the coordination of test plans, test cases, and documentation and troubleshoot interface issues, providing timely resolution and updates;

  • Provide cross-functional support to a variety of HR initiatives; Maintain positive relationships with key users in each area to stay current on how they use the various systems and offer recommendations and support for using core applications;

  • Serve as system administrator to manage roles, permissions, and settings for users in the LMS, ATS and or HR related platforms. Audit and make recommendations on permissions and optimal use of business systems to leverage data for process improvements;

  • Stay abreast of industry trends and emerging technologies to inform the continuous evolution of the HR technology strategy; Ensure system compliance with data security, record retention and privacy requirements and data regulations;

  • Collaborate with leaders to create a culture of innovation and continuous improvement within the HR function through the thought leadership in the solutioning of an on-going scalable HR technology architecture;

  • Establish and maintain strong partnerships with external vendors, ensuring the integration of innovative solutions into HR processes and systems; Serve as primary/lead contact for software vendors to report, track and resolve problems with their software products;

  • Partner across HR and the enterprise by serving on committees, RFP panels, and other operational plan projects to adopt solutions that are extensible, reusable, secure, reliable, cost optimized and operationally sound;

  • Partner with HR leadership and stakeholders to develop and maintain the multi-year HR technology roadmap and strategy;

  • Perform other duties as assigned.
